About

Jonathan Fang is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Surgery and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Jonathan Fang has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 164 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, 11 papers in Surgery and 3 papers in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ine. Recurrent topics in Jonathan Fang's work include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(9 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(5 papers) and Cardiac pacing and defibrillation studies (3 papers). Jonathan Fang is often cited by papers focused on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(9 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(5 papers) and Cardiac pacing and defibrillation studies (3 papers). Jonathan Fang collaborates with scholars based in United States, Hong Kong and China. Jonathan Fang's co-authors include Chung‐Wah Siu, Hung‐Fat Tse, Chor Cheung Tam, Yiu Tung Anthony Wong, KS Cheung, Arthur Yung, Simon Lam, Jo Jo Hai, Chu‐Pak Lau and Chun‐Ka Wong and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American College of Cardiology, Heart Rhythm and Journal of Clinical Medicine.
